Description Sawtooth Concepts is looking for a Construction Project Coordinator to work closely with the Project Managers to develop and coordinate schedules, monitor project progress, and ensure that projects are completed according to schedule and specifications. What You Will Do: Communicate and schedule tasks and detailed items via CRM & Project Management software Prepare and coordinate field measurement, delivery & installation schedules, resources, equipment and information Prepare comprehensive action plans, including resources, timeframes, and budgets for projects Prepare appropriate paperwork (e.g. installation drawings, contracts, warranties, etc.) as directed Document significant events and changes to projects and complete change orders as directed Monitor project progress and resolve basic issues that arise, notifying leadership of more complex issues Regularly communicate with drafters, project managers, contractors, customers, and production to provide updates, clarify details, and resolve issues Submit and track orders for installation materials Complete change orders required for site changes Ensure clients’ needs are met as projects evolve Participate in quality control during manufacturing and installation process Participate in cabinet production, construction, and installation as directed Work closely with the Project Managers, Shop Foreman and Installation Foreman to ensure supplies maintain proper inventory levels Trim component parts of joints to ensure snug fit using hand tools such as planes, chisels, or wood files Assemble cabinet parts with glue, nails, or other fasteners and fit, and clamp parts and subassemblies together to form units Sand and scrape surfaces and joints to prepare components for finishing Install hardware such as hinges, catches, and drawer pulls Restock parts and hardware, unload, sort, and put away materials in the shop Clean and maintain shop work areas, including machinery and tools, to ensure a safe working environment Perform all other assigned tasks and requirements as needed We're Looking For: 2 years of project coordination or similar work preferably in the construction industry Associate degree in Construction Management, Architecture, or Project Management or equivalent experience Basic knowledge of project management principles, practices, techniques, and tools Use of computers and programs such as Microsoft Office, Zoho CRM & Zoho Projects is required Knowledge of commercial and residential construction principles, documents, techniques, and procedures Good communication skills Strong customer service skills Strong organizational and time management skills Ability to read and understand specifications and architectural drawings Good work prioritization skills with the ability to coordinate multiple projects at the same time Ability to maintain general job costs and project budgets Ability to obtain a forklift certification may be required
